Millenials 'spending £44k more on rent by age 30 than baby boomers'

Millennials face paying £44,000 more on rent typically by the time they turn 30 than the baby boomer generation, analysis from a think-tank has found.

The Resolution Foundation said a combination of falling home ownership levels among the younger generation and rising costs in the private rented sector have fuelled the increase.
